Reducing a Bulky Jawline
For those with a naturally square or bulky jawline due to overactive masseter muscles, Botox injections can be used to slim the jawline. By relaxing these muscles, Botox creates a more tapered and feminine jawline, which can significantly enhance the overall facial profile.
Minimal Downtime
Botox treatments are minimally invasive and require little to no downtime, making them a convenient option for younger individuals with busy lifestyles.
Non-Surgical Lifting and Contouring
Thread lifting is an increasingly popular non-surgical option for individuals in their 40s and 50s who want to address early signs of aging in the jawline. This procedure involves inserting dissolvable threads under the skin to lift and tighten sagging tissues, resulting in a more defined jawline.
Stimulating Collagen Production
In addition to providing immediate lifting effects, thread lifts stimulate collagen production, which helps improve skin quality and maintain the results over time.
Skin Tightening Through Ultrasound
Ultherapy is a non-invasive treatment that uses ultrasound energy to tighten and lift the skin around the jawline and neck. This treatment is particularly effective for individuals in their 40s and 50s who are beginning to notice skin laxity but are not yet ready for surgical options.
Long-Lasting Results
The results of Ultherapy can last up to a year or more, making it a popular choice for those seeking long-term improvement without the need for frequent maintenance.

Restoring Jawline Definition
A neck lift is particularly effective for older individuals who have developed pronounced sagging in the neck and jawline area. By tightening the skin and removing excess fat, a neck lift can restore the sharpness of the jawline and improve the overall appearance of the lower face.
Combining with Jawline Contouring
For the best results, a neck lift is often combined with jawline contouring procedures to ensure that the face and neck look balanced and rejuvenated.
Restoring Volume and Contours
Fat grafting is a technique where fat is harvested from another area of the body and injected into the jawline to restore volume and enhance contours. This treatment is particularly beneficial for individuals who have experienced significant fat loss in the face, leading to a hollow or gaunt appearance.
Natural and Long-Lasting Results
Because fat grafting uses the patient’s own fat cells, the results are natural-looking and can last for many years. This treatment is ideal for older individuals seeking a more subtle and natural enhancement.
